Short bio
Sule Koc is an Istanbul based industrial designer. She mostly focused on product, event and exhibiton design projects. Participated in several design exhibitions and recognized by Red Dot Design and Design Tukey Superior Design Awards. By means of design, she is in search for productivity, sustainability, being aware and actively expressive. Her works are simple, emotional, and thought provoking. Leading people through experiences and inspiring them has been the major motive of her works.
